Output 52064cdd0731d4383d6008778c4aac4adf423696f23244a0d4b8ee61fdf0951f:0

value
1520115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89614b1e87628b1966ff9394539e6cddff34051 OP_EQUAL
address
3MSDfn7idvy16AqxfUGs4oN47CWWmNu9WJ
transaction
52064cdd0731d4383d6008778c4aac4adf423696f23244a0d4b8ee61fdf0951f
spent
true